DatenbankenMaya Kindler 6c
Allgemein•möglichst strukturierter Ausschnitt aus
der Wirklichkeit.
•Datenbank besteht aus Tabellen
•Tabellen bestehen aus Datensätzen
•Datensätze bestehen aus Datenfeldern
Allgemein•Primärschlüssel und Sekundärschlüssel
(Fremdschlüssel)
•Ermöglichen relationale Datenbanken
•Relationale Datenbanken Tabellen stehen in Beziehung zueinander
Relationale Datenbank
Alle Tabellen stehen in Verbindung
Primärschlüssel, Sekundärschlüssel
Primärschlüssel wird hier definiert
Und hier als Fremdschlüssel verwendet
Autoinkrement•Es wird automatisch eins hochgezählt
•Primärschlüssel wird automatisch über autoinkrement erstellt
•Dieser Wert wird in einer anderen Tabelle als Sekundärschlüssel verwendet
Datenbanken mit Access•Man erstellt eine „leere Datenbank“
•Hier braucht man Tabellen (Tabellen erstellen)
• Entwurfsansicht
•Primärschlüssel definieren ( mit AutoWert= autoinkrement)
•Weitere Datenfelder bestimmen (PLZ,Ort,...)
Datenbanken mit AccessPrimärschlüssel
Autoinkrement
Datenbanken mit Access
•Weiter Tabellen erstellen
•Sekundärschlüssel durch normales Datenfeld (Kundennummer, Personalnummer,...) erstellen
•Nun hat man Beziehungen erstellt
Datenbanken mit Access1.Tabelle
Verwendet als Sekundärschlüssel
2.Tabelle
Primärschlüssel
Datenbanken mit Access
•Wenn man alle Tabellen erstellt und gespeichert hat auf Datenbank Tools und auf „Beziehungen erstellen“
•Primär- und Sekundärschlüssel mit einander verbinden Beziehungen erstellen
•Nun kann man Zusammenhänge sehen
Datenbanken mit Access- Übersicht